– I would like to explore all the children in Poland. If we detect diabetes mellitus at a very early stage, we can delay the onset of the disease, protect the child from ketoacidosis, and in the future from chronic complications, says prof. Artur Bossovski, specialist in pediatrics, endocrinology, diabetology, as well as pediatric endocrinology and diabetology.

Katarzyna Pinkosz, Wprost: Children, even infants, often have type 1 diabetes. It is alarming that Poland is a country with a rapidly increasing number of children with type 1 diabetes. Until now, it was believed that nothing could be done to prevent this disease. So why are you testing children in Podlasie between the ages of 1 and 9 to see if they develop this disease?

prof. Arthur Bosovsky: We have a dramatic increase in the incidence of type 1 diabetes in children - not only in Poland, but throughout Europe, as well as in the United States, South America and Australia. Most cases are in Scandinavia (mainly Finland and Norway) and Sardinia in Italy. Dynamics is very growing.

Where did this increase come from? Type 1 diabetes is not affected by poor diet or lack of exercise…

It is difficult to answer this question unambiguously.
